You would have to complete at least some undergrad classes in the US in addition to MCAT in order to apply to med school here. There are schools that do not require UG prepreqs completed in the US but there are VERY few and VERY hard to get into (i.e. WashU or Harvard). Best recommendation to you is to work on getting your medical degree in the Philippines and studying for the USMLE at the same time and then just take the Step exams. If you get a good grade, there would not be too much trouble getting into a residency in the US... it probably wont be a dermo residency (of course depends on your USMLE score, if they are through the roof, the sky is the limit), but you probably will get into a residency program. In addition, many US med schools (i.e. Hopkins, WashU, NYMC, and others) require 100% prepayment of medical school tuition + living expenses (about $220,000-240,000) upfront payment.
